MK Elektronik sp. j.
Menu

Czym jest DCIM?

08.05.2018

 

    Kłopoty stojące przed właścicielami centrum danych lub samych administratorów nie skupiają się tylko i wyłącznie na dbaniu o wydajność przesyłanych danych. Głównym zadaniem i nieraz najtrudniejszym są rosnące koszty energii i nieefektywne zarządzanie dostępnymi zasobami. Aby prawidłowo tym zarządzać wystarczy użyć odpowiednich narzędzi. Serwerownia (ang. Computer Room) znajdująca się w sercu budynku Centrum Danych (ang. Data Center) potrzebuje odpowiedniego optymalnego zarządzania jej zasobami, najważniejszymi z nich są:

  • energia elektryczna;
  • klimatyzacja;
  • dostępne miejsce w szafach;
  • dostępne porty w urządzeniach aktywnych;
  • stała inwentaryzacja.

     Powszechnie znane systemy optymalizacji i zarządzania Data Center zwane są: „Monitorowaniem elementów aktywnych w centrum danych” skrót z angielskiego DCIM (ang. Data Center Infrastructure Management). Jeszcze do niedawna DCIM kojarzyły się tylko z nadzorowaniem i wizualizacją stanu połączeń sieciowych pomiędzy poszczególnymi urządzeniami IT w serwerowni. Wiele osób do dzisiaj postrzega je właśnie w ten sposób.

Jednak, na przestrzeni lat systemy DCIM rozwinęły się w kierunku masowego narzędzia, zarządzającego praktycznie całą infrastrukturą fizyczną serwerowni. Dzisiaj jest to podstawowe źródło informacji o tym:

  • co faktycznie w Data Center jest zainstalowane;
  • czy działa optymalnie;
  • czy jest właściwie serwisowane;
  • co może się stać w przypadku awarii któregoś z urządzeń;
  • jak w sposób graficzny zobrazowane są stojaki i ich lokalizacja;
  • jakie ciepło generowane jest przez urządzenia w pomieszczeniu.

 

patchpanel16

 

    Według modelu OSI warstwa fizyczna jest podstawą dowolnego centrum danych, dlatego bardzo ważne jest zrozumienie, jak wszystko jest połączone, aby ułatwić efektywne zarządzanie zmianami i zminimalizować ryzyko lub wpływ na biznes w przypadku wystąpienia jakichkolwiek problemów. W tym momencie pojawia się wizualne wyobrażenie na temat omawianego oprogramowania. Czyli, mamy budynek, w którym znajduję się pomieszczenie z dużą ilością szaf telekomunikacyjnych bądź serwerowych (powiedzmy powyżej 10szt.). Każda szafa składa się z aktywnych urządzeń typu switch lub serwer, które wydzielają dużo ciepła oraz potrzebują odpowiednio dużo mocy, ale kto by się tym przejmował. Zazwyczaj administrator sieci lub opiekun serwerowni ma zupełnie odmienne zadania niż zamartwianie się temperaturą w pomieszczeniu i zużyciem prądu. Jak będzie za gorąco to „podkręci” klimatyzację i temat załatwiony. Okazuje się, że ta informacja jest bardzo cenna gdyż zwiększone ciepło w pomieszczeniu ma bezpośredni wpływ na utrzymanie stabilnej temperatury w serwerowni. Współcześni producenci urządzeń elektrycznych umieszczanych w szafach dostosowują swój sprzęt do pracy w wyższych temperaturach i nie ma konieczności utrzymywania niskiej temperatury w pomieszczeniu. Ważne jest aby temperatura była optymalna i stała.

 

patchpanel11

 

    Dlaczego to jest takie ważne? Otóż większa temperatura w pomieszczeniu wymaga zwiększenia zasobu klimatyzacji co wiąże się ze zwiększeniem poboru energii elektrycznej czyli zasobu energii, który ma bezpośredni wpływ na straty mocy oraz większe rachunki. Wyznacznikiem dostępnej energii w centrum komputerowym są UPS’y. Przy wyborze właściwego UPS’a bierze się pod uwagę jego maksymalną dostarczaną moc np. 100MW, 100kW czy 1MW w zależności od wielkości centrum danych. I w tym przypadku również należy odpowiednio zarządzać wartością zużywanej mocy aby nie przekroczyć maksymalnej wartości mocy UPS’a. Dzieje się tak dlatego, że klimatyzacje projektowane są pod względem jej obciążenia elektrycznego (współczynnik liczony 1:1 tak, że 1kW zużytej mocy proporcjonalnie do 1kW wyprodukowanego ciepła). W uproszczeniu można powiedzieć, że 1 szafa ze względu na dostępność energii i wymogi klimatyzacji maksymalnie może być obciążona przykładowo 10kW (standardowe zużycie 1 szafy kształtuje się w zakresie 3-6kW), ta wartość jest dość duża dlatego wymaga zoptymalizowania przez lepsze zarządzanie zużyciem każdej z dostępnych szaf oraz odpowiednie zaopatrzenie szaf w serwerowni.

 

patchpanel42

    Takie urządzenia jak klimatyzatory, oświetlenie, dodatkowe systemy pobierające energie są systemami wspomagającymi, które przynoszą głównie straty. Światowym wyznacznikiem określającym efektywność centrum danych jest PUE (ang. Power Usage Effectiveness) jest to różnica pomiędzy wartościami: ile mocy jest dostarczona do centrum komputerowego podzielona przez moc, która zużywana jest przez aktywne elementy (switche i serwery). Wskaźnik PUE powinien być jak najmniejszy, bliski 1. Standardową wartością PUE jest 2.0 – 2.5 PUE (Firmy Amazon lub Google chwalą się, że ich serwerownie mają współczynnik bliski 1.1 PUE). Głównym celem optymalizacji takich budynków jest to aby cała energia dostarczona do centrum danych trafiała do urządzeń aktywnych i żeby centrum danych zarabiało na siebie. Gdyż zastosowanie nawet najbardziej zaawansowanych systemów aktywnych nie zapewnia zwrotu kosztów inwestycji.

EquinixSVDC-1024x694

     Dlatego potrzebne są systemy monitorowania elementów aktywnych w centrach danych, właśnie po to aby głównie obniżyć koszty energii elektrycznej. Przy okazji dodatkowych funkcji jakie oferują dostępne na rynku oprogramowania warto wiedzieć co się dzieje w serwerowni (zasób szafy, dostępne miejsce w szafie), bez konieczności podchodzenia do każdej z szaf. Problem jest o tyle mniejszy jeżeli dotyczy małych serwerowni z szafami poniżej 10 sztuk, ale proszę sobie wyobrazić ogromne centra danych gdzie szaf może być od 50 do nawet 200 sztuk. Wtedy te kłopoty okazują się istotne gdyż oszczędności przy tak ogromnych inwestycjach są bardzo ważne.

patchpanel14

     Wyobraźmy sobie sytuację, że potrzebujemy dodatkowego serwera. Aby zrobić to w miarę sprawnie to opiekun serwerowni chodzi po pomieszczeniu w poszukiwaniu wolnych jednostek RU, lub zna na pamięć rozkład każdej szafy i wie, że akurat w szafie 11. w rzędzie 20. powinno być miejsce na serwer. Jakie musi być jego zdziwienie jak okazuje się, że wcześniej już ktoś tam wstawił inne urządzenie, ale nikogo o tym nie poinformował. W tym momencie następuję burza mózgu i poszukiwanie w pamięci podręcznej danej osoby kolejnego dostępnego miejsca. Komizm w tej sytuacji jest nad wyraz przesadzony, bo można tymi czynnościami zarządzać z poziomu oprogramowania DCIM i sprowadza się to najczęściej do paru ruchów myszką.

patchpanel12

    W sytuacji gdy już wiemy gdzie znajduje się szafa i ile mamy dostępnego miejsca, kolejną niewiadomą jest zasób dostępności portów sieciowych w patchpanelach, switchach i serwerach znajdujących się w serwerowni. Monitorowanie dostępnych portów sieciowych w urządzeniach aktywnych umożliwia sprawdzenie w jaki sposób serwer połączony jest ze switchem albo z patchpanelem, a on z innym patchpanelem np. za pomocą miedzianych przewodów lub światłowodów. Konieczność wymiany okablowania łączy się ze zwiększonym zapotrzebowaniem przepustowości i prędkości przesyłanych danych. A żeby móc w ogóle o tym myśleć należy znać te wszystkie połączenia. Czyli potrzebna jest szczegółowa dokumentacja połączeń infrastruktury fizycznej szafy. I w tym momencie dochodzimy do zasobu inwentaryzacji, bo jeżeli mamy już wszystko udokumentowane w oprogramowaniu to w każdej chwili można sprawdzić czy konkretny sprzęt w szafach jest nadal na gwarancji, kiedy przewidziana jest konserwacja, kto wprowadził ostatnie zmiany.

Mając to wszystko w jednym miejscu, życie właścicieli centrum komputerowych staje się automatycznie prostsze. Optymalizując te wszystkie zasoby, zyskuje się:

  • zmniejszenie kosztów utrzymania;
  • zwiększenie wydajności całego centrum;
  • optymalizację i stały monitoring warunków panujących w serwerowni (DCIM zbiera w czasie rzeczywistym specyficzne dane dotyczące poboru mocy i warunków środowiskowych);
  • efektywne zarządzanie dostępnymi zasobami (DCIM zapewnia możliwość manipulowania wirtualnym modelem centrum danych, tworząc wymyślne scenariusze typu „what if” w celu rozpoznania, jak przemieszczenia, dodawanie i wymiana zasobów będą wpływać na pobór mocy oraz na zapotrzebowanie na chłodzenie i powierzchnię);
  • przygotowanie modelu wirtualnych zmian (DCIM zapewnia możliwość definiowania i sterowania realizacją procesów zlecania usług, używając graficznego przepływu zadań i automatycznego ich wykonywania (ang. taski), co w efekcie zapewnia lepsze świadczenie usługi oraz skraca czas wdrażania serwera);

   Narzędzia DCIM są już obecnie używane w nowoczesnych centrach danych i czasy planowania wyposażenia centrów danych za pomocą arkuszy kalkulacyjnych odchodzą w niepamięć. Na ich miejsce wchodzi oprogramowanie DCIM. Prawdziwy system monitorowania powinien pomóc Wam zrozumieć jak funkcjonuje całe centrum danych. Ponieważ każda zmiana optymalizująca jeden z powyższych zasobów ma wpływ na całkowity majątek inwestycji.

Przydatne linki:

  • Artykuł „The Organizational Benefits & Technical Capabilities of Next Generation Intelligent DCIM” w ENG firmy Panduit (link);
  • Oprogramowanie DCIM firmy Panduit Synapsense (link);
  • Artykuł na moim prywatnym blogu: DCIM.
Pobierz nasz
najnowszy katalog
Zainteresowałeś się naszymi produktami? Pobierz bezpłatnie darmowe katalogi i materiały promocyjne POBIERZ KATALOG
Ostatnio na blogu

Opaski i uchwyty z tworzywa Tefzel 280

    Jako zagorzały fan motoryzacji przy okazji premiery najdroższego (~70 mln zł) cywilnego samochodu marki Bugatti model La Voiture Noire (franc. czarny samoch... Czytaj dalej >

Zainteresowany? Skontaktuj się z nami. Chętnie odpowiemy na Twoje pytania